1940: Edward U. Condon designs a computer that plays a game.

1956: Arthur Samuel plays checkers against a computer on national T.V.
1962: An MIT student invents the first computer-based video game.
1971: Three college students create the hit game Oregon Trail.
1977: Atari releases its Video Computer System with multiple game cartridges.
